Bright, crystalline tones cut through ambient noise with an unmistakable metallic snap, instantly signaling both movement and urgency. Generated from a small, brassâreinforced handbell commonly found on bicycles, the waveform reveals a sharp attack followed by a clean, rapid decayâjust long enough to linger in the ear before fading. The timbral color is pure, featuring a faint harmonic tremolo that gives it an almost translucent glow, yet the overall texture remains uncluttered, so it stands out without cluttering dialogue tracks or lowerâmid frequencies.
Spatially, the bellâs acoustic fingerprint feels closeârange yet expansive, ideal for foreground interaction cues in user interfaces or subtle inâscene triggers within urban cinematography. Its stereo imaging preserves a directional focus; slight panning and dynamic EQ can simulate the bell ringing from across a city block or from the passenger seat of a commuter bike. When layered behind a background rumbleâa street soundscape or distant trafficâyouâll notice a subtle âwhooshâ sense of speed as if the rider skims past, reinforcing kinetic energy.
The realism of the recording shines in its subtle distortion under higher gain levels, echoing realâworld imperfections that happen when metal strikes metal. That authenticity allows editors to integrate it directly into dialogue-driven scenes without the risk of sounding synthetic or fabricated. In game development, designers often employ this cue as a navigation hint or item pickup alert, leveraging its immediate recognizability to guide player attention. For podcasts or online content, a single burst of this bright chime can punctuate transitions or serve as an engaging notification sound, keeping listeners anchored amidst auditory chaos.
